If your walls are finished (drywall or plaster), retrofitting with injection foam is often the least disruptive DIY method—especially compared to traditional batt or blown-in options that require more demolition. However, safety is critical: if your home has knob-and-tube electrical wiring (common pre-1950) or visible moisture issues, professional assessment is a must. Closed-cell spray foam is rated for its air sealing and moisture-resistance, but it won’t repair structural or electrical hazards—those need solutions first.Check for brick, stone, or double-layered plaster walls, which require specialty tools and techniques (and often a pro installer). Modern drywall with wood studs is ideal for homeowner projects.Preparation: The Goldilocks PhaseSmart prep work is where most DIY insulation projects are won or lost. Start by finding all studs using a reliable stud finder, and mark them with removable painter's tape—accuracy matters to avoid damaging wiring or plumbing. Clear the workspace: move nearby furniture and lay heavy-duty drop cloths.Plan for small, 1.5”–2” holes between each set of studs at chest height. These will let you feed in the foam nozzle. If you’re unsure what’s behind the wall, invest in a cheap borescope camera (about $30 online) for peace of mind. Remember—any holes will patch easily with joint compound and touch-up paint when you’re done.Choosing the Right Spray Foam ProductPick a slow-rise, closed-cell spray foam kit made for wall injection. These are formulated to safely expand within finished walls without exerting pressure that could damage drywall or plaster. Avoid open-cell foams unless your wall structure specifically permits, as their rapid expansion can create bulges or leaks.Always check for third-party safety and performance certifications (UL, GREENGUARD, or ICC-ES). This ensures compliance with local building codes and minimizes VOC emissions, an important health consideration.Step-by-Step: DIY Spray Foam Insulation for Existing Walls1. Gear Up and Review SafetyWear protective goggles, nitrile gloves, and an N95 mask for fume protection.Ventilate the room: open windows, use a fan, and tape off adjacent rooms.Double-check for hidden wires or pipes at each spot before drilling (a simple circuit tester helps).2. Drill Access HolesDrill 1.5”-2” holes between each set of studs, staying at least 8” from outlets or switches.If resistance is met, stop—don't force the drill.3. Inject the FoamFollow manufacturer’s instructions closely—attach the long nozzle and aim at the cavity bottom first.Squeeze foam in slowly, watching for any resistance or backflow.Work in small vertical sections (typically between two studs).Pause if you see foam backing out or if you meet pressure; overfilling can split drywall seams.4. Patch and FinishLet foam cure for at least 8–24 hours—the manufacturer's timeline is key.Patch holes with joint compound or pre-fab wall patches. Sand smooth, repaint, and your secret is safe!Common DIY Pitfalls and Professional-Quality FixesNever skip safety gear—spray foam chemicals can cause irritation.Don’t try to insulate active moisture-prone walls (fix leaks first).Never inject foam around knob-and-tube wiring—it’s a serious fire risk.Take “before” photos of wall interiors (if accessible) to help future upgrades or repairs.Work in stages—overfilling can lead to unsightly bulges and extra repair time.For more guidance, consult the U.S. Department of Energy's spray foam insulation guide.Energy Efficiency Gains & What to ExpectOnce installed properly, spray foam insulation significantly cuts drafts, stabilizes indoor temps, and can lower heating and cooling costs by 10–20% annually, according to DOE data. It’s also excellent for noise reduction and allergy relief, as it seals out dust and pollen. But, missing a section or not sealing up access holes correctly can undercut these benefits.Maintenance is minimal—just monitor for any new moisture intrusion or structural settling near patched areas. Keep manufacturer manuals and batch info for future warranty or code compliance needs.Tips 1: Start SmallIf this is your first spray foam project, choose a less trafficked room (such as a guest bedroom or utility space) as your proving ground. This lets you build skills, confidence, and a system for prep and cleanup before moving on to more prominent rooms.Tips 2: Maximize ROIFocus spray foam upgrades on the draftiest, coldest sides of your home, usually northern or wind-exposed walls. This targeted approach yields the highest comfort and energy bill returns for your time and materials investment.Tips 3: Pair Spray Foam with Air SealingSeal any accessible electrical penetrations, attic hatches, and window frames before or after installing wall spray foam. Using code-approved products and maintaining records of the installation helps avoid headaches down the line.FAQQ: Can I add spray foam wall insulation without removing drywall? A: Yes, with closed-cell injection kits, you can insulate most finished walls through small, patchable holes—no demo required.Q: How much does DIY spray foam cost? A: On average, $1.50–$3 per square foot, per NAHB benchmarks—DIY is typically 50–70% less than hiring a pro, depending on the wall accessibility and square footage.Q: Will spray foam cause moisture issues? A: Quality closed-cell spray foams resist moisture, but they don’t eliminate existing leaks or condensation. Always resolve moisture before insulating.Q: Is spray foam safe around wiring? A: Safe on modern, up-to-code wiring. For older "knob-and-tube" or aluminum wiring, get pro guidance to avoid safety hazards.Q: How can I check wall cavities for obstacles before drilling? A: Use a borescope (inspection camera) or review original house plans.
